Output a64859cad2588866378f89ed9325afbf7f59f45e6a8b66b2b18abb4e4aba4a98:0

value
627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f8d488da06a30301bb4420fc0150e7bf0f42fa1 OP_EQUALVERIFY OP_CHECKSIG
address
19iESmWV4yL8upTB5DepSZEpmmABJP2Xh8
transaction
a64859cad2588866378f89ed9325afbf7f59f45e6a8b66b2b18abb4e4aba4a98
confirmations
493056
spent
true